Program Structure
|
Resident assignments and programs are designed to meet the objectives
of the individual resident insofar as possible, taking into account the
resident's progress in professional development and the overall opportunities
and requirements of the program. The program fosters the development of
the resident's teaching abilities. The department has a broad-based didactic
curriculum and conference program. As members of the resident staff of
teaching hospitals, residents are expected to attend and participate in
appropriate conferences and educational activities of the institution
and department. Residents must participate in activities of the medical
staffs of the hospitals and must adhere to the established practices and
procedures. The socioeconomics of health care and the importance of cost
containment are emphasized. |
